With growing concerns about water conservation and planetary health, homeowners are increasingly seeking sustainable solutions for their daily lives. One such solution is the transition to dual flush tank toilets, which offer a significant advantage over traditional water closets. These innovative toilets feature separate flushing mechanisms, allowing users to choose between a full or partial flush based on their needs. By selecting the appropriate flush setting, individuals can conserve water, contributing to a more sustainable future.

Dual flush toilets are not only environmentally friendly but also offer practical benefits. The ability to choose between different flush volumes provides targeted flushing for various waste types. Furthermore, these toilets often come with modern functionalities, adding a touch of elegance to any bathroom.

Eco-Friendly Toilets: Water Saving Technology for Every Home

Water is a precious asset that needs to be managed responsibly. Traditional toilets can consume a substantial amount of water with each flush, contributing to water shortages and environmental problems. Thankfully, eco-friendly toilets are emerging as a brilliant solution to address this issue. These modern fixtures utilize water-saving technology to dramatically minimize water consumption without compromising flushing performance.

Including dual-flush systems that allow you to choose the amount of water used based on the type of waste to dry toilets that transform waste into valuable fertilizer, eco-friendly options address a spectrum of needs and preferences.

Modern Toilets with Integrated Odor Control

Today's toilet systems are becoming increasingly sophisticated, incorporating innovative features to enhance comfort and hygiene. One particularly noteworthy advancement is the integration of odor control directly into the toilet itself. This eliminates the reliance on liquid fresheners, providing a more sustainable approach to odor management.

These modern toilets often employ intelligent systems that detect and neutralize unpleasant odors in real time. Some models utilize air purifiers to effectively remove odor molecules from the bathroom air, while others incorporate odor-absorbing materials to trap and eliminate odors at their source. The result is a consistently fresh and comfortable bathroom environment.
